Remparts d'argile /

When the inhabitants of her village are hired to cut rock salt, a young Tunisian woman sees the possibility of a more liberated life style outside of the rigidly structured village, where ancient customs demand that women be in a subservient position in life.

Item Description:Based on the book Chebika by Jean Duvignaud.
Originally produced as a motion picture in 1968.
A foreign film (France, Algeria)
